How to connect LiveChat and Formstack
Create a New Scenario to Connect LiveChat and Formstack
In the workspace, click the โCreate New Scenarioโ button.

Add the First Step
Add the first node โ a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a LiveChat,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, LiveChat or Formstack will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find LiveChat or Formstack,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Add the LiveChat Node
Select the LiveChat node from the app selection panel on the right.

Authenticate Formstack
Now, click the Formstack node and select the connection option. This can be an OAuth2 connection or an API key, which you can obtain in your Formstack settings. Authentication allows you to use Formstack through Latenode.
Configure the LiveChat and Formstack Nodes
Next, configure the nodes by filling in the required parameters according to your logic. Fields marked with a red asterisk (*) are mandatory.

Save and Activate the Scenario
After configuring LiveChat, Formstack, and any additional nodes, donโt for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Test the Scenario
Run the scenario by clicking โRun onceโ and triggering an event to check if the LiveChat and Formstack integ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between LiveChat and Formstack (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.
Most powerful ways to connect LiveChat and Formstack
LiveChat + Formstack + Slack: When a chat is deactivated in LiveChat, the transcript is sent to Formstack to create a form submission. A message is then sent to a dedicated Slack channel to notify the team about the new form submission.
Formstack + LiveChat + Google Sheets: Upon submission of a new form in Formstack, a new row is added to Google Sheets. This event triggers an immediate LiveChat conversation to qualify the lead.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ating LiveChat with Formstack?
Integrating LiveChat with Formstack allows you to perform various tasks, including:
- Create new Formstack submissions from LiveChat transcripts.
- Update existing Formstack submissions based on LiveChat interactions.
- Trigger LiveChat chats when a new Formstack submission is received.
- Send automated summaries of LiveChat transcripts to Formstack.
- Store LiveChat transcripts as attachments in Formstack submissions.

Are there any limitations to the LiveChat and Formstack integration on Latenode?
While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:
- Complex data transformations may require JavaScript knowledge.
- Real-time data synchronization is subject to API rate limits.
- File size limits apply when transferring attachments between apps.
